What are some of the easy things that anyone can do to keep improving their Creativity?

 Creativity is the ability to think outside of the box and come up with new and innovative ideas. Here are some easy things that anyone can do to improve their creativity:

  1. Take a break: Taking a break from your routine can help refresh your mind and give you a new perspective.

  2. Read and learn something new: Reading and learning about new topics can help broaden your horizons and give you new ideas.

  3. Play and experiment: Play around with different materials and techniques to explore new possibilities and find your own unique style.

  4. Surround yourself with creativity: Surround yourself with creative people and things that inspire you, whether it's art, music, or nature.

  5. Take risks: Don't be afraid to try new things and take risks, even if they don't work out as planned. Failure is a part of the creative process.

  6. Keep a notebook: Carry a notebook with you at all times and jot down any ideas, thoughts, or observations that come to mind.

  7. Get outside: Nature is a great source of inspiration and getting outside can help you clear your mind and think more creatively.

  8. Practice mindfulness: Mindfulness practices such as meditation or yoga can help you stay present and focused, which can help boost creativity.

  9. Step out of your comfort zone: Push yourself out of your comfort zone and try new things, whether it's taking a class, learning a new skill, or traveling to a new place.

  10. Play with ideas: Allow yourself to play with different ideas, no matter how wild or crazy they might seem, it's a good way to stimulate your imagination.
